New sod installation offers an immediate, lavish yard and is an efficient method to renew exhausted or bare areas. Appropriate site preparation is essential, consisting of soil screening, grading, and removal of debris or old plants. The chosen sod type must match climate conditions, sunlight exposure, and intended yard use. Installation involves laying the sod in staggered rows, making sure tight joints and even coverage. Immediate watering helps develop roots and avoids drying out. Subsequent care consists of regular watering, mowing, and fertilization to support strong, healthy development. New sod provides immediate visual appeal, lowers erosion, and produces a practical outdoor area quickly compared to seeding. With appropriate upkeep, it turns into a durable, appealing yard that boosts the residential or commercial property's general landscape
